Decoding Gymshark Sizing: Do Gymshark Clothes Run Small?
Navigating the world of activewear can sometimes feel like a guessing game, especially when it comes to sizing. Many fitness enthusiasts wonder, "Do Gymshark clothes run small?" The answer isn’t a simple yes or no. While Gymshark sizing is generally designed to be true to size, individual experiences can vary based on the specific garment, the fabric blend, and personal body shape.
Understanding Gymshark’s Fit Philosophy
Gymshark aims to create performance wear that fits well and moves with you. Their design team generally adheres to standard sizing charts. However, the brand offers a wide range of collections, each with a slightly different aesthetic and intended fit. Some lines, like their seamless collections, are designed to be more form-fitting and compressive.
Other collections might feature a more relaxed or oversized fit. This variety means that what might feel snug in one style could feel looser in another. Therefore, it’s crucial to look beyond the general reputation and investigate the specifics of the item you’re interested in.
Factors Influencing Gymshark Sizing Perception
Several factors contribute to how people perceive Gymshark’s sizing:
- Fabric Stretch and Compression: Materials like elastane offer significant stretch. Seamless leggings, for instance, are often designed for a compressive fit, which can feel tighter than non-compressive leggings.
- Collection-Specific Cuts: Different collections are tailored for different purposes. Training wear might be cut for maximum mobility, while lifestyle wear could prioritize a more casual, relaxed silhouette.
- Body Shape Variations: What fits one person perfectly might not fit another the same way, even if they are the same size according to a chart. Individual proportions, such as torso length or leg length, can influence how a garment drapes and feels.
- Customer Reviews: Real-world feedback from other shoppers is invaluable. Many customers leave detailed reviews about the fit of specific items, often mentioning if they sized up or down.

Common Fit Experiences by Product Type
While generalizations can be tricky, here’s a breakdown of common fit experiences across popular Gymshark items:
Gymshark Leggings Sizing
Gymshark leggings are perhaps their most popular item. Many find their seamless leggings offer a snug, supportive fit. If you prefer a less compressive feel or are between sizes, sizing up might be a good option for these.
Their training leggings, often made with different fabric blends, can sometimes offer a bit more room. Again, checking the specific product description and reviews is key. For example, the Adapt Fleck Seamless Leggings might fit differently than the Vital Seamless Leggings.
Gymshark Sports Bras Sizing
Sports bras are crucial for support. Gymshark offers various support levels. A high-support sports bra will naturally feel tighter and more compressive than a low-support bralette. Ensure you measure your band and cup size accurately. Many reviews suggest going up a size if you are between sizes or prefer a less constrictive feel.
Gymshark Tops and T-Shirts Sizing
Tops and t-shirts can vary from fitted designs to oversized fits. The "Athlete" collection, for instance, often features a more relaxed, athletic cut. If you’re looking for a baggy fit or an oversized look, you might consider sizing up. For a more standard fit, stick to your usual size.
What to Do If You’re Unsure About Your Size
If you’re still on the fence about your size, here are some actionable steps:
- Consult the Size Chart: This is your primary resource.
- Read Product Reviews: Look for comments specifically mentioning fit and sizing.
- Check the Model’s Size: Gymshark often lists the size the model is wearing, which can provide a good reference point.
- Consider Fabric Composition: Look for details about stretch and compression in the product description.
- Contact Customer Service: If all else fails, reach out to Gymshark’s customer support for personalized advice.
